Why are you playing on an 8x8 board? The table generally should be 6x4, so you have a good amount of maneuvering room, but are still close enough to have stuff happen. An 8 foot table with Orks on it just means the boyz can't accomplish anything.

Lootas will do the trick, and a shokk attack gun might work too. Also, a deffrolla battlewagon can mulch a defiler. First off play on a table that isn't so stacked though.
